Output 5ae1e06b53e500a76b019c866d69e15ba10fe27845d67dd0a9b69737ec0bd329:0

value
588650874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d8c3910572165bea510e989bc4f192de02d17df OP_EQUAL
address
MC3zcvMxiesK23uYexfHr8R6HB44ECu3ZH
transaction
5ae1e06b53e500a76b019c866d69e15ba10fe27845d67dd0a9b69737ec0bd329
spent
true